The Effect DVD- The Award Winning Rope Magic of Tabary- Volume 1

Cost £17.99 (or £25 for the two volume version)

Difficulty 3=Some sleights used,

Review

I got the two volume set but so far have only worked on volume 1 so a volume 2 review will come when I've gone through that.

The first thing that disapointed me when I first put this disk in and played it was that it was in black and white. I believe that the disk is an American format disk and doesn't play properly on my player. This is just a minor point really, as the disc was still watchable.

Contained on the disk is 2 performances by Tabary and the tutorials. Every time I see his routine, it amazes me and the performances on the disk did just that.

In the tutorial he goes over every single detail very well. His accent can make things hard to understand and he seems to do everything in the wrong hands but you soon get used to these points.

He teaches each step of the routine brilliantly, his explainations are at a good pace and he shows you the moves from different angles.

The thing that I love is that it would be very easy to chop and change the routine to make it your own, each of the steps could be performs as tricks in their own right and many could be left out or indeed others could be added very easily if you were to want to alter your performance length.

All in all, this a very good and well thought out routine and his methods are brilliant. It will take some work to perfect but that's time well worth spent.

Overall

7/10 (just let down by the fact that the DVD is american format)

For the black and white problem. It could be for one of these reasons:

Your TV is quite old, or your DVD player is quite old.
The cable is not a true RGB scart cable.
The scart cable is in the wrong scart socket in the TV, if there's other inputs try it in there.
Your DVD player may not be set to output in NTSC.


Or you could copy the DVD on your PC and convert it to PAL in the process.

It's a great routine but not as interchangeable with other rope routines as you mnay think - this is because the Tabary routine uses diferent rope lengths and much of his sleights happen in the opposite hands to other rope sleights. However, with patience this CAN be worked out.

I recommend Fibre Optics, Flips rope routine and Jahn Gallos ring and rope and then try Daryls encyclopedia of rope magic.

I'd say that from a magicians perspective, Tabary is always the rope routine that gets the first mention and is perhaps the most satisfying to learn as it is one of the most difficult ones, because of the rope lengths, and understanding Tabary's accent :wink: .

From a lay person's perspective, I'd say that Fibre Optics is the best as it't this one that always gets me the most gasps from an audience and it's much much easier to intergate with other pieces from Flip, Gallos and Daryl's collections.

My personal preference for Fibre Optics is to start and end with Joe Riding's cut and restored routine so I begin and end with a single piece of rope with most of Fibre Optics performed in the middle.

However, just one of these titles will get you bye as some impressive rope magic unless like me, you're really into your ropes and want to specialise.
